Output 354c264eccbe564866a803f52c5356af89026f7a86a72040fe795b88e6f38b0e:0
- value
- 2683379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8570b1351f15e7515f133384aead177cebca4659 OP_EQUAL
- address
- 3Drao3qRPfXGBoUpbWWxJ9PbWfvuttgvk1
- transaction
- 354c264eccbe564866a803f52c5356af89026f7a86a72040fe795b88e6f38b0e
- spent
- true